Output 90e4a544889814264ccb21fad8263a44098ad5cff7370619278c478c76630907:0

value
1832214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38d5974fcfc367a8499971d308f2b295333db040 OP_EQUAL
address
36sXdrT3y8YWxpoDcfasB7jjNush2pFRHe
transaction
90e4a544889814264ccb21fad8263a44098ad5cff7370619278c478c76630907
spent
true